Understanding hCG:
Human chorionic gonadotropin (hCG) is a hormone produced by the placenta during pregnancy. Its levels rise rapidly in the early stages of gestation, peaking around the 10th week before gradually declining. hCG plays a crucial role in supporting pregnancy by stimulating the production of other hormones necessary for fetal development.
The Role of hCG in Spontaneous Abortion:
Detection and Confirmation: In early pregnancy, hCG levels can be measured through blood or urine tests to confirm pregnancy. A significant drop in hCG levels or a failure to rise as expected may indicate an impending spontaneous abortion. Monitoring hCG levels can provide valuable insights into the viability of the pregnancy.
Diagnosis of Ectopic Pregnancy: Ectopic pregnancies, where the fertilized egg implants outside the uterus, are associated with a higher risk of spontaneous abortion. hCG levels can help diagnose ectopic pregnancies by measuring their rate of increase. Slower or abnormal rises in hCG levels may indicate an ectopic pregnancy, which requires immediate medical attention to prevent complications.
Prediction of Pregnancy Outcome: Serial hCG measurements can be used to predict the likelihood of spontaneous abortion. A significant decrease or plateauing of hCG levels may indicate an impending miscarriage. However, it is important to note that hCG levels alone cannot definitively predict the outcome, and additional diagnostic tests may be required.
Monitoring After Miscarriage: Following a spontaneous abortion, hCG levels should be monitored until they return to normal. A gradual decline in hCG indicates that the uterus is emptying properly. Persistently high levels may indicate retained tissue, infection, or other complications that require medical intervention.
